Rectangular drains, often referred to as linear drains, have transitioned from luxury hotel specifications to a standard requirement in global residential and commercial construction. Driven by the "Universal Design" movement and ADA (Americans with Disabilities Act) compliance, procurement officers in North America and Europe now prioritize sleek, barrier-free drainage systems that ensure safety without compromising aesthetics.
The global construction industry is moving toward modularity and efficiency. Rectangular drains offer a distinct advantage over traditional center drains by allowing for a single-slope floor design. This reduces labor costs in tiling and waterproofing while significantly improving the hydraulic performance of large-scale wet areas, making them indispensable for hospitality and healthcare projects.

ADA compliance requires a "curbless" or "zero-entry" design. Rectangular drains are ideal because they can be placed along the wall or at the entrance, allowing the floor to slope in one direction without requiring a raised threshold. This provides the necessary clearance for wheelchair access.
While 304 is the industry standard for most residential and commercial bathrooms, 316 stainless steel contains molybdenum, which provides superior resistance to chlorides (salts). We recommend 316 for outdoor wetrooms, swimming pools, or coastal installations.
